Regulations of Shanghai Municipality on Promoting the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service"
(Adopted at the 29th Session of the Standing Committee of the 16th Shanghai Municipal People's Congress on March 31, 2026)
Article 1
With a view to further implementing the national strategy for the integrated development of the Yangtze River Delta region, advancing the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", better satisfying the needs of enterprises and individuals in obtaining government services, fostering a market-oriented, law-based, and internationalized first-class business environment, and promoting high-quality economic and social development, these Regulations are formulated in accordance with relevant laws and administrative regulations, and the Outline of the Integrated Regional Development of the Yangtze River Delta, and in the light of the actual circumstances of this Municipality.
Article 2
These Regulations apply to activities undertaken within this Municipality to promote work related to the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service".
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, optimize cross-provincial/municipal, cross-departmental, and cross-level administrative processes. Under the guidance of the principle of "one-stop government services," this Municipality shall expand both online and offline service channels. By means of the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", enterprises and individuals shall be enabled to handle government service items across provinces (municipality) within the Yangtze River Delta conveniently, efficiently, and with the benefit of local access.
Article 3
The Municipal People's Government shall, in collaboration with the People's Governments of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, leverage the three-tier operational mechanism for regional cooperation in the Yangtze River Delta to deliberate on and advance the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", and coordinate major issues concerning government services that span provinces/municipality, departments, and administrative levels.
The General Office of the Municipal People's Government shall, in collaboration with the competent departments for government services of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, be responsible for advancing the specific work of the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service". They shall jointly formulate work plans, implementation schemes, and policy measures for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", and oversee their implementation.
The following departments shall, in accordance with their respective duties, duly carry out work related to the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service": Development and Reform; Economy and Informatization; Commerce; Education; Science and Technology; Public Security; Civil Affairs; Judicial Administration; Finance; Human Resources and Social Security; Planning and Natural Resources; Ecology and Environment; Housing and Urban-Rural Development; Transport; Agriculture and Rural Affairs; Water Affairs; Culture and Tourism; Health; Veteran Affairs; Market Regulation; Data; Financial Regulation; Sports; Healthcare Security; Landscaping and City Appearance; Intellectual Property; Press and Publication; Archives Administration; Talent Affairs; and Tax Service.
The Shanghai-based offices of the maritime safety, customs, and central financial regulatory authorities shall, in accordance with state provisions, duly perform work related to the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service".
Article 4
The service items to be provided under the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service" shall be administered through a list-based management system.
The General Office of the Municipal People's Government shall, in collaboration with the competent departments for government services of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, be responsible for jointly compiling and publishing the service list for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service". The scope of listed services shall be progressively expanded in response to the needs of enterprises engaging in cross-regional business operations and individuals requiring services in different localities. The list shall clearly specify the service items, modes of provision, responsible departments, and other relevant information. During the compilation process, opinions from the public and relevant departments shall be solicited in advance.
The service list for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service" shall focus on addressing enterprise-related service demands in areas including but not limited to market access, business commencement and operation, recruitment and employment, tax filing and payment, business development, construction projects, and business de-registration and exit. It shall also address individual service demands in areas such as birth, education, employment, talent services, daily life, property acquisition, travel, healthcare, social assistance, elderly care, and post-life affairs. Furthermore, the initiative shall progressively introduce value-added services in fields such as policy consultation, legal affairs, finance, scientific and technological innovation, and international trade.
Article 5
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, streamline the development of government service channels within the Yangtze River Delta, ensure the operation of the online platform for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", and promote the online processing of a greater number of government services across provincial and municipal boundaries.
This Municipality shall, jointly with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, enhance the establishment of dedicated offline service counters for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", providing consultation, application assistance, and document receipt services in connection with the initiative.
This Municipality shall, in cooperation with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, promote the integration of online and offline service channels. Remote virtual service windows for the Yangtze River Delta shall be set up as needed at government service locations, utilizing technologies such as remote identity verification, audio-video interaction, and screen sharing to provide cross-regional assistance and remote processing services.
The departments responsible for services under the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service" shall promptly make public the online and offline service channels, along with relevant service guides, to facilitate access and inquiries by enterprises and individuals.
Article 6
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, innovate the service models of the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", optimize and integrate processing procedures, and enhance cross-provincial/municipal, cross-departmental, and cross-level coordination and data sharing, thereby achieving successive processing, integrated processing, and application-free fulfillment:
1. For government services that need to be handled across multiple provinces or municipality, such as relocation and resettlement, transfer and continuation, a system shall be implemented whereby an applicant files an application in one location and the relevant authorities in multiple locations collaborate to complete the procedures in sequence;
2. For cross-provincial/municipal services that involve multiple departments, are highly interrelated, involve high processing volumes, or are time-sensitive, steps shall be taken to progressively enable their efficient, integrated processing based on a single application; and
3. For policies benefiting enterprises and the public, dedicated service spaces for enterprises and individuals shall be established on the online platform of the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service" to proactively deliver suitable cross-provincial/municipal policies, thereby promoting the "enjoyment without application" and "direct and fast enjoyment" mechanisms.
Article 7
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, improve the service standards and norms for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", clarifying the procedures for business process flows and the specific division of collaborative responsibilities. It shall also enhance the level of standardization in the handling of government services, promote the harmonization of acceptance conditions, handling procedures, required application materials, and processing timelines for the same government service items for enterprises and individuals, and accelerate the achievement of consistent standards for the same government service items across different regions.
In accordance with state provisions, this Municipality shall, in cooperation with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, promote the cross-provincial/municipal, cross-departmental, and cross-level interoperability and mutual recognition of electronic certificates, electronic seals, and electronic signatures, and shall expand the scope of their application in the field of government services.
This Municipality shall, jointly with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, promote the mutual recognition and sharing of service information and processing outcomes in areas including production and business operations, education, employment, and healthcare.
Article 8
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, leveraging the national integrated government big data system, strengthen the inter-regional coordination mechanism for government data sharing within the Yangtze River Delta, improve the Yangtze River Delta data sharing and exchange platform, and facilitate the safe, orderly, and efficient sharing and utilization of government data.
The municipal department in charge of data shall, in coordination with the data departments of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, and based on the service list for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service" and the needs arising from high-frequency services, establish a government data sharing catalogue. It shall promote the unification of business data standards, and improve both the efficiency of data sharing and the quality of data provision.
This Municipality shall, in cooperation with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, enhance the full-lifecycle security protection of government data in accordance with law, ensure the security of the government networks and data of the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", and safeguard state secrets, personal privacy, personal information, commercial secrets, and confidential business information.
Article 9
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, promote the safe, prudent, and orderly application of digital-intelligent technologies, such as artificial intelligence, in the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service". Efforts shall be made to strengthen the development of high-quality datasets, corpora resources, and reliable knowledge bases, enhance public-sector computing capacity, and provide services such as intelligent guidance, intelligent pre-filling, and intelligent assistance to enterprises and individuals, thereby enhancing the overall intelligence of government services.
Article 10
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, encourage the participation of social actors in the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", providing diverse, efficient, and convenient service channels for enterprises and individuals.
Entities such as banks and postal service providers are encouraged to integrate government services into their self-service terminals, thereby facilitating convenient local access for enterprises and individuals.
Article 11
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, strengthen communication with the competent government service departments of the State Council and relevant national authorities, and shall actively advance pilot reforms in government services.
This Municipality supports the Yangtze River Delta Ecological and Green Integrated Development Demonstration Zone, as well as other qualified areas, in taking the lead to expand the service scope of the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", pioneer new service models, and establish optimal destinations for cross-provincial/municipal government services.
Article 12
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, and leveraging the "Satisfaction Evaluation" System for government services and the 12345 Government Service Hotline, establish a working mechanism for collecting, distributing, and collaboratively researching, and handling opinions and suggestions from enterprises and individuals concerning the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service".
The General Office of the Municipal People's Government shall, in coordination with the competent departments for government services of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, enhance the monitoring of the operational performance of the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service" and continuously improve the quality and efficiency of its services.
Article 13
In formulating local regulations, government rules, major policies, and local standards related to the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service", this Municipality shall strengthen communication and coll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ces.
This Municipality shall, in collaboration with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, enhance the exchange of and mutual learning from innovative government service measures, and jointly advance the replication and dissemination of proven effective practices and experience within the Yangtze River Delta.
Article 14
This Municipality shall incorporate the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service" into the key work of the Municipal People's Government, with the requisite funds allocated within the fiscal budget in accordance with the relevant provisions.
The General Office of the Municipal People's Government shall, in collaboration with the competent departments for government services of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Anhui Provinces, strengthen regular exchanges, conduct joint training programs, and establish an expert advisory system to provide professional advice and technical support for the Yangtze River Delta "One-Net Service".
Article 15
These Provisions shall be effective as of May 1, 2026.
